Understanding Double Suction Pumps
Double suction pumps are designed to handle large volumes of water with minimal operational costs and high efficiency. Unlike standard single-suction pumps, which draw water from one side, double suction pumps utilize two inlets, allowing them to draw water simultaneously from both sides of the impeller. This design not only increases the flow rate but also reduces the axial thrust on the shaft, leading to enhanced durability and reliability.
These pumps are typically used for applications where the volume of water required is significant, and the risk of cavitation and other operational issues must be minimized. The engineering behind double suction pumps allows them to operate efficiently at lower energy levels, making them an environmentally friendly choice in industrial applications.
Advantages of Clean Water Double Suction Pumps
1. Increased Efficiency One of the most significant advantages of double suction pumps is their efficiency. By taking in water from both sides, they can produce a higher flow rate with less energy input compared to single suction pumps. This efficiency translates into lower operational costs and reduced energy consumption, which are crucial aspects for industries looking to optimize their processes.
2. Durability and Robustness Double suction pumps are engineered to withstand harsh operational environments. Their design minimizes wear and tear, which extends the lifespan of the pump. This durability ensures reliability in critical water supply applications, reducing maintenance costs and downtime.
3. Reduced Noise and Vibration Traditional pumps often encounter issues with noise and vibration, especially at higher flow rates. The construction of double suction pumps, however, helps to balance these factors effectively. This balance results in quieter operations, which is beneficial for installations in residential or sensitive environments.
4. Versatility Clean water double suction pumps can be utilized in various applications. From large-scale municipal water systems to agricultural irrigation and industrial manufacturing processes, their adaptability makes them invaluable across different sectors. Additionally, they can handle a variety of clean water conditions, making them suitable for diverse operational needs.
